Identify common handheld portable digital devices
Identify common handheld portable digital devices
Multimedia player
A portable multimedia player is an electronic device that is capable of storing and playing digital media.
A portable multimedia player is sometimes called a PMP, and if capable of playing video as well as sound sometimes referred to as a portable video player, or PVP.
Digital audio players (DAP) that can also display images and play videos are PMPs.
With all of these portable multimedia players the data is typically stored on a small hard drive, a microdrive, or flash / SD memory.
Other types of electronic devices like cellphones are sometimes referred as PMPs because of their playback capabilities - and many cellphones now feature integrated music players and video players.
